ProSidian Seeks a Workforce Relations Specialist in CONUS/OCONUS - Seattle, WA to support an engagement for an agency within the United States Department of Commerce that focuses on the conditions of the oceans, major waterways, and the atmosphere. The ProSidian Engagement Team Members work to provide multi-functional mediation and/or arbitration services for conflict resolution among personnel in various offices and platforms of the National Oceanic and Atmospheric Administration (NOAA). Creating a safe, civil, and productive work environment is paramount to the mission of the NOAA and its offices. The purpose of conflict resolution within NOAA offices is to acknowledge and address conflicts before they become a serious issue. Workforce Relations Specialist Candidates shall work to support requirements for Program Support and The Workforce Relations Specialist will provide mediation for conflict resolution among various offices and platforms within the National Oceanic and Atmospheric Administration's Office of Marine and Aviation Operations (OMAO). This person will collaborate with the OMAO Human Resources team to provide support conflict resolution on a variety of complex employee relations matters. These matters include disciplinary actions, policy interpretation, employee issues, unpleasant event occurrences, etc. Lead detailed, factual employee relations reviews and summarize findings in a written report. Research and understand agency policies, guidelines, etc. to better assess conflict. Collaborate with OMAO personnel and HR to review current and potential conflicts that arise in employee/agency interactions. Provide completely neutral guidance to effective conflict resolution. Provide guidance to the OMAO and its employees in various matters. Identify mediation trends and adhere to best conflict resolution practices. Have a strong understanding of federal government business operations and work process. Support project teams and program managers and provide daily execution assigned work functions. Summarize issues and findings in a clear and logical manner. Have strong analytical and problem solving skills. The Workforce Relations Specialist shall have consecutive employment in a position with comparable responsibilities within the past five (5) years, Must be able to use a computer to communicate via email; and proficient in Microsoft Office Products (Word/Excel/Power point) and related tools and technology required for the position. Requirements include: Bachelor’s degree from an accredited college or university in a relevant field with at least five years of experience in mediation, arbitration, law, human resources, and formal conflict resolution. Mediation/arbitration training REQUIRED with proof of extensive work history within the industry and/or credentials. At least 5 years relevant experience in mediation/arbitration. Experience in formal alternative dispute resolution (ADR) services is a plus, but not required.
